远程连接Linux系统:开启全新连接体验(远程连接linux系统)
远程连接Linux系统是多个人同时连接和操作同一台服务器的技术。随着Web 2.0及其社交媒体的引爆,企业的IT系统的要求也已发生了巨大的变化,企业必须能够远程连接到Linux系统,以便能够更高效地完成一系列任务,同时确保安全性和数据完整性。本文将详细介绍如何远程连接Linux系统,以开启全新的连接体验。
首先,为了远程连接Linux系统,我们需要使用Secure Shell(SSH)协议进行远程访问,这是一个可靠而安全的加密协议,它可以完美地解决企业IT系统中的远程连接问题。不同的Linux发行版都会有不同的安装方式,但是我们可以使用通用的安装脚本来确保成功安装。大多数Linux发行版都已经预装了SSH服务器,但如果我们希望设置专用的SSH连接,我们也可以使用以下安装指令:
$ sudo apt-get install openssh-server
接下来,要确保我们可以正常打开SSH服务,需要检查本地Linux系统中的防火墙的配置,确保SSH通信端口(默认为22)已经被打开。检查防火墙配置可以使用以下命令:
$ sudo systemctl status ssh
如果我们希望在特定端口提供服务,可以使用以下命令来关闭端口:
$ sudo ufw deny port_name
最后,当防火墙配置完毕后,就可以使用远程连接客户端软件来连接服务器了,比如Windows中的Putty,我们需要输入服务器的IP地址和SSH端口号,然后输入服务器的用户名和密码,就可以获取到远程登录服务器的shell权限了。
此外,为了增强远程连接体验,我们可以使用“密钥认证”(key-based authentication)来实现SSH登录,具体步骤如下:
1)Windows本地生成公私钥对。
2)将公钥复制到Linux服务器。
3)修改SSH服务器的配置文件,设置使用公钥认证。
以上就是使用SSH远程连接Linux系统的全部步骤,通过参考以上的操作步骤,我们可以很好地操作Linux系统,开启全新的连接体验。